This technique, known as context reinstatement, is a great way to aid people in remembering where their belongings are. Key Fobs Key fobs are also referred to as proximity keys and smart keys. They come with security chips which send signals to the car that open its doors or even start it. They come in two types: key fobs, which connect to a keychain that have buttons that can perform various functions as well as combo keys which are all one piece. If your unit isn't working correctly, it could mean that the battery requires replacement. It's simple to replace the battery at the big-box retailer or at a hardware store. The owner's guide for cars (or an online search) will give you the correct instructions specific to your model. Key fobs that lose power are among the most frequent problems. This means you are unable to use the remote keyless entry feature to lock your vehicle or open it. Transponder Keys Transponder keys add an extra layer to security in any vehicle. They are equipped with an RFID microchip, which transmits digital signals when they are they are inserted into the ignition. If the immobilizer recognizes the digital ID, it will disengage and allow the car to start. This prevents hot wiring and other techniques that could be used to steal cars. They are not foolproof, and criminals have found ways to circumvent them. It's important to always keep a spare. Some transponder keys utilize a fixed code, while other, such as those made by GM and others, have a rolling code that is changed every time the key is used. This prevents anyone trying to duplicate your key and then use it to start your vehicle, because the rolling code changes every time the key is used. These kinds of keys are more costly to replace, but they also offer an extra layer of security that can help protect your vehicle from theft.
